      The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Threadloom (Palo Alto, CA)

      Interview

      Paul, the CEO, reached out to me via email. We had a chat about the company and the role a few days later, a full day onsite a week later, and an offer quickly followed. The whole process was really fast and a testament to their small and agile size that they are able to mobilize so quickly. The whole team seemed very talented, ethical, experienced, and with a great attitude. They are one of the friendliest teams I've interviewed with. The business is pretty interesting and they've definitely found a good way to approach the problem space. The only reason I didn't take the offer was due to another offer that that more closely fit my academic background.
